dungeons

英 [ˈdʌndʒənz]

美 [ˈdʌndʒənz]

n.  (尤指城堡中的)地牢,土牢
dungeon的复数

柯林斯词典

  • (城堡中的)地牢,土牢
    Adungeonis a dark underground prison in a castle.
